| 2008 Have a Heart Bursary Program |
Canadian Cardiovascular Society Academy (CCSA) is calling for applicants for the 2008 Have a Heart Bursary Program
The Have a Heart Bursary Program is a travel bursary designed to introduce promising Canadian medical students, postgraduate trainees and basic scientists-in-training to the cardiovascular sciences by attending the Canadian Cardiovascular Congress (CCC).
The CCC is an outstanding venue for students to learn and meet the Canadian leaders in cardiovascular medicine. Don't delay! The application deadline is June 30th, 2008. Submit online at: www.ccs.ca.
Note: Applicants should be committed to a future career in Canada. Those already established in a cardiovascular residency program are not eligible to apply. |

CCC Trainee Events The Canadian Cardiovascular Society and the Canadian Cardiovascular Society Academy are proud to offer the following programs to complement trainees' CCC experience. The following programs are designed by trainees.
7th Annual Canadian Cardiovascular Trainee Day Saturday, October 25, 2008, 8:00-17:00 Training Cardiovascular Leaders of Tomorrow
Trainee Day is a day for learning and networking with a flexible format to maximize value for all who participate.
9th Annual Cardiovascular Trainee Luncheon Sunday, October 26, 2008, 12:00-14:00
The Trainee Luncheon will provide networking opportunities among trainees and senior CCS members.
